Traditional Japanese restaurant with hibachi tables, multicourse dinners & a sake & beer selection.

Lori Smith
This Japanese steak house has been a staple in northwest OKC for years. I have celebrated many birthdays here. The food is still very good and consistent every time. I feel like the decor has not changed either in all these years. The dried up fountains in the eating rooms might need a little refresher. Our chef was not very entertaining this last trip either. No fancy food tricks or shots of shrimp in your face. Kind of disappointing. I hope this was just a slow night and a chef in training because I have lots of love for this icon of food history in Northpark Mall. I will still return soon and hope for the best.

Catherine Sturtevant
It’s not clear what happened here, but this Shogun was EXTREMELY understaffed. They might have had 2 chefs and 2 servers.

It took nearly 10 minutes for us to be seated – with a reservation. Once we were seated, it took almost 15 minutes to get a drink. We were not served our first food until about an hour after our reservation time, about 45-50 minutes after being seated.

To cap it off, the chef clearly had limited or no hibachi training. He did his best, but the food was sub-par and BLAND for a hibachi restaurant, and there was essentially no show.

And finally, to add insult to injury, the prices were SIGNIFICANTLY higher than menu price. We understand supply chain issues, but the difference was about 20%. Ridiculous, given the poor quality and service.

I don’t blame the staff. I feel they did their best, but clearly there are serious issues at this restaurant. The server was kind and patient, the chef was nice, but clearly this staff is out of their depth.

We will try again after a significant period of time, once this restaurant has had time to recover from whatever disaster caused its major issues.
